iphone 4 Full Price

16gb = $599
32gb = $699


Iphone 3gs Full Price

8gb = $499

here's the new pricing

iPhone 8GB 3GS
WAS-$499
NOW-$474

iPhone 4 16GB
WAS-$599
NOW-$649

iPhone 4 32GB
WAS-$699
NOW-$749
